Abnormal Security, a pioneer in protecting large enterprises from Business Email Compromise (BEC) attacks announced completion of the Service Organization Control (SOC 2) examination of the Abnormal Cloud Email Security Platform, earning SOC 2 Type 2 compliance. Conducted by Coalfire Controls, LLC, a fully licensed, accredited CPA firm and an affiliate of Coalfire Systems, Inc, the voluntary examination confirms Abnormal Security’s commitment to inscrutable operating effectiveness.

The Abnormal Cloud Security platform protects enterprises from the most sophisticated, targeted email attacks including BEC, which has led to more than $26B in financial loss, according to the FBI.
The platform is powered by Abnormal Behaviour Technology (ABX), which models the identity of both employees and external senders, graphs the relationships between people and organisations, and analyses email content to stop attacks that lead to financial fraud, account takeover, and organisational mistrust.
SOC 2 Type 2 compliance
SOC 2 Type 2 compliance demonstrates assurance that service commitments and system requirements about the controls in place relevant to Common Criteria/security and confidentiality of the systems used to process user data and the confidentiality of the information processed can be achieved.
Completion of the SOC 2 Type 2 examination indicates that selected Abnormal Security infrastructure, software, people, data, processes, and procedures have been formally reviewed.
